Marston Green offers a variety of facilities to enhance your travel experience. The station is equipped with a ticket office and accessible machines to ensure smooth ticket purchases and collections. Operating hours for the ticket office are ample—ranging from early mornings until 19:00 on weekdays and slightly extended hours on weekends. For those who need assistance, help points and staffed support are readily available during ticket office hours, making it easier for travelers to navigate their journey.
Despite the absence of a lounge, first class amenities, or luggage storage, the station caters to the essential needs with accessible toilets, seating areas, and induction loops for the hearing impaired. Bicycle storage is available and includes both stands and lockers for travelers who prefer to cycle to or from the station.
The station prides itself on being accessible to everyone. With step-free access throughout, it is classified as a Category A station, ensuring easy movement for wheelchair users and travelers with reduced mobility. While there aren’t wheelchair loans or accessible taxis directly on-site, there are multiple accessible parking spaces, and the helpful staff are always on hand to assist with any inquiries.
Security is also a priority, with the station accredited by the Secure Station Scheme and CCTV installed for peace of mind.
Marston Green is well-connected beyond just train journeys. With bus services including rail replacement options conveniently accessible from the station front, onward travel is straightforward. Although there is no direct airport shuttle, taxis are available for quick access to nearby Birmingham International Airport.
For those eager to explore Birmingham further, bus routes and taxi services like Marston Green Cars are readily available, ensuring you can seamlessly drift between train travel and local exploration. Polsloe Bridge is a simple station with limited facilities, ideally suited for seasoned travelers who appreciate a no-fuss experience. There isn’t a ticket office, nor are there ticket machines for buying or collecting pre-purchased tickets. While there are no refreshment facilities or shops on-site, passengers can connect to free public Wi-Fi provided by "GWR Free Station WiFi". Listening to playlists or catching up on the latest news is just as seamless as the trains themselves.
For those with accessibility needs, it's important to note that Polsloe Bridge does not offer step-free access to the platform, and there are no accessible ticket machines. However, the station does feature an induction loop and customer help points for any immediate queries. If you're traveling and require assistance, booking can be arranged up to two hours before your journey begins through the Passenger Assist service.
When it comes to onward connections, Polsloe Bridge is well-integrated with local transport services. Rail replacement buses, when needed, pick up from nearby Widgery Road bus stops along Pinhoe Road. Detailed travel information is conveniently available for print here. Additionally, taxis are easily accessible, departing from the front of the station, making your onward journey straightforward and hassle-free.
